Deitz Dittrich Posted January 8, 2007 Share Posted January 8, 2007 Its going to depend on bottom content and depth you are fishing.. The softer the bottom and the shallower you are fishing, the less problems you are going to have with the units working together.. If you are in 30+ feet of water over rock.. YOU WILL HAVE PROBLEMS!... if your fishing 10 feet over a soft bottom.. you should be fine.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
